Output da3aa4d22daa805ec8428bfbb2bdc9facb3c42306bfba998a1431024a6069405:6

value
7525158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c8660bca2cb6c19ef72ce410d88e5e0c7592c04 OP_EQUAL
address
3LLSkR57PdAFgQkggCVHebEvt9RkaiePt5
transaction
da3aa4d22daa805ec8428bfbb2bdc9facb3c42306bfba998a1431024a6069405
spent
true